3-Cyano-4-isopropoxybenzoic Acid
This compound is a critical building block in the synthesis of advanced pharmaceuticals, offering unique chemical properties for targeted drug development. Its molecular structure facilitates key reactions in creating complex therapeutic molecules.

Key Advantages
Versatile Pharmaceutical Intermediate
As a key intermediate for Ozanimod and Dyclonine Hydrochloride, its versatility in pharmaceutical synthesis is paramount for drug development.
Targeted Biological Activity
Its ability to inhibit xanthine oxidase makes it a valuable compound for developing treatments for hyperuricemic conditions.

Key Applications
Pharmaceutical Synthesis
Serves as a crucial intermediate in the multi-step synthesis of various active pharmaceutical ingredients (APIs).
Medicinal Chemistry Research
Investigated for its potential to modulate biological targets like sphingosine phosphate receptors, relevant for autoimmune and neurological diseases.
Gout Treatment Development
Acts as a precursor to drugs that lower uric acid levels by inhibiting xanthine oxidase.
